Owners of smart home systems will be able to use artificial intelligence agents to control devices connected to Google Home. According to TechCrunch, Google opened early access to the Google Home ecosystem Model Context Protocol (MCP) server on Tuesday. This will allow any MCP-enabled AI agent (such as Claude, Hermes, OpenClaw, ChatGPT, or Google Antigravity) to securely interact with smart home devices and access event history.

With this update, users will be able to issue natural language commands to perform actions such as viewing camera sources, monitoring home activity, controlling connected devices, and building their own smart home dashboards.
To set up a connection, users need to create a project in Google Cloud and configure it to work with Home MCP. You then need to pass the MCP configuration parameters to the selected agent and issue the configuration command. The agent will ask the user to log in and provide the necessary permissions. The Google Home Developer Center also provides setup instructions.
The system will support any device in the Google Home ecosystem, including Google Nest doorbells and thermostats, as well as work with Google Home certified (or Matter-compliant) devices, such as smart light bulbs.
Google already uses MCP in other areas of its business, notably Google Cloud, Data Platform, Developer Tools, and Google Workspace. Google Home support is primarily aimed at consumers trying to use artificial intelligence agents to perform everyday tasks.
The company said it will roll out MCP access to Google Home Premium Advanced users in the United States in phases starting today and over the coming weeks. This is a more expensive plan ($20 per month) that includes expanded storage of event video recordings, informational notifications and detailed alerts, a video search tool, daily summaries, and more.
Google wouldn’t comment on if or when MCP will be rolled out more broadly, such as with other pricing plans or in other markets. The company also noted that it will collect feedback from early adopters through its smart home developer community.
